    Would you guys mind telling me how like a 950gma, 8400m gs, 8600m gt, and a x3100 all compare to a radeon 9200se?

    8600m gt >>>> 8400m gs >>>>>>> x3100 >9200se >> 950gma


    more greater sign = much greater

    aka

    8600gt is MUCH MUCH better than the 950gma
    is a lot better than the 9200
    is also a lot better than the x3100
    is about 2x as good as the 8400gs
